Transaction 2a279c86a6635f32cbff66fd5d2d64f633d824581837917fd46050bf12aca078
1 Input
1 Output
-
2a279c86a6635f32cbff66fd5d2d64f633d824581837917fd46050bf12aca078:0
- value
- 1011786
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 590cc2c686000eb86705923695c9ff332aa572a3 OP_EQUAL
- address
- 39osMFmiUBMx1DqwUdE2KQJzmxUpNLgYGD